The cheapest way to get from Bermagui to Adelaide is to bus which costs $75 - $280 and takes 25h 25m.
The fastest way to get from Bermagui to Adelaide is to bus and fly which takes 7h 37m and costs $550 - $950.
No, there is no direct bus from Bermagui to Adelaide. However, there are services departing from Bermagui and arriving at 85 Franklin St via Apex Park, Vulcan St, Canberra and Albury Station/Hume Hwy.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 25h 25m.
The distance between Bermagui and Adelaide is 1151 km. The road distance is 1303.6 km.
The best way to get from Bermagui to Adelaide without a car is to bus and train via Melbourne which takes 23h 36m and costs $250 - $500.
It takes approximately 7h 37m to get from Bermagui to Adelaide, including transfers.
